Output 7ddab7926cbce4090115055aa422e71f54f4a4d5d72db86aa004541ef96c0a1d:1

value
18796000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 129bd35b14e41170409f4c30d2bce2d31c038dd4 OP_EQUAL
address
33PQkx3MXwTXo6MYRWT1ockkNCnsBETFWQ
transaction
7ddab7926cbce4090115055aa422e71f54f4a4d5d72db86aa004541ef96c0a1d
spent
true